Tom Lane a4e775a263 Make use of new error context stack mechanism to allow random errors
detected during buffer dump to be labeled with the buffer location.
For example, if a page LSN is clobbered, we now produce something like
ERROR:  XLogFlush: request 2C000000/8468EC8 is not satisfied --- flushed only
to 0/8468EF0
CONTEXT:  writing block 0 of relation 428946/566240
whereas before there was no convenient way to find out which page had
been trashed.

Tom Lane fd42262836 Add code to apply some simple sanity checks to the header fields of a
page when it's read in, per pghackers discussion around 17-Feb.  Add a
GUC variable zero_damaged_pages that causes the response to be a WARNING
followed by zeroing the page, rather than the normal ERROR; this is per
Hiroshi's suggestion that there needs to be a way to get at the data
in the rest of the table.

Tom Lane 5df307c778 Restructure local-buffer handling per recent pghackers discussion.
The local buffer manager is no longer used for newly-created relations
(unless they are TEMP); a new non-TEMP relation goes through the shared
bufmgr and thus will participate normally in checkpoints.  But TEMP relations
use the local buffer manager throughout their lifespan.  Also, operations
in TEMP relations are not logged in WAL, thus improving performance.
Since it's no longer necessary to fsync relations as they move out of the
local buffers into shared buffers, quite a lot of smgr.c/md.c/fd.c code
is no longer needed and has been removed: there's no concept of a dirty
relation anymore in md.c/fd.c, and we never fsync anything but WAL.
Still TODO: improve local buffer management algorithms so that it would
be reasonable to increase NLocBuffer.

Tom Lane 499abb0c0f Implement new 'lightweight lock manager' that's intermediate between
existing lock manager and spinlocks: it understands exclusive vs shared
lock but has few other fancy features.  Replace most uses of spinlocks
with lightweight locks.  All remaining uses of spinlocks have very short
lock hold times (a few dozen instructions), so tweak spinlock backoff
code to work efficiently given this assumption.  All per my proposal on
pghackers 26-Sep-01.

Tom Lane 2589735da0 Replace implementation of pg_log as a relation accessed through the
buffer manager with 'pg_clog', a specialized access method modeled
on pg_xlog.  This simplifies startup (don't need to play games to
open pg_log; among other things, OverrideTransactionSystem goes away),
should improve performance a little, and opens the door to recycling
commit log space by removing no-longer-needed segments of the commit
log.  Actual recycling is not there yet, but I felt I should commit
this part separately since it'd still be useful if we chose not to
do transaction ID wraparound.

Tom Lane eedb7d18fa Modify RelationGetBufferForTuple() so that we only do lseek and lock
when we need to move to a new page; as long as we can insert the new
tuple on the same page as before, we only need LockBuffer and not the
expensive stuff.  Also, twiddle bufmgr interfaces to avoid redundant
lseeks in RelationGetBufferForTuple and BufferAlloc.  Successive inserts
now require one lseek per page added, rather than one per tuple with
several additional ones at each page boundary as happened before.
Lock contention when multiple backends are inserting in same table
is also greatly reduced.

Tom Lane 642107d5ba Avoid unnecessary lseek() calls by cleanups in md.c. mdfd_lstbcnt was
not being consulted anywhere, so remove it and remove the _mdnblocks()
calls that were used to set it.  Change smgrextend interface to pass in
the target block number (ie, current file length) --- the caller always
knows this already, having already done smgrnblocks(), so it's silly to
do it over again inside mdextend.  Net result: extension of a file now
takes one lseek(SEEK_END) and a write(), not three lseeks and a write.

Tom Lane 496ea7a876 At least on HPUX, select with delay.tv_sec = 0 and delay.tv_usec = 1000000
does not lead to a one-second delay, but to an immediate EINVAL failure.
This causes CHECKPOINT to crash with s_lock_stuck much too quickly :-(.
Fix by breaking down the requested wait div/mod 1e6.
